| p adverse action 12m | 0.1 | — | v0.1 | default · in composite | R23/W4-3. Deterministic logistic p(Medicare termination within 12m), SNF only. Label = first POS termination date (any code: voluntary closure, involuntary termination, merger exit); facilities already terminated by the panel date are excluded, not counted as safe. Trained on panels 2024-07/2024-10/2025-01 (n=46,466, 283 positives), evaluated on the held-out later panel 2025-04 BEFORE shipping: AUC 0.971, top-decile lift 9.5x, top-decile capture 95.4% of the 65 terminations that followed. Separability is high because closures announce themselves in the data: collapsing occupancy is the strongest signal, and the learned NEGATIVE weight on 12m deficiency counts is the surveys-stop signature of a facility winding down, not a claim that clean inspections are dangerous. Same 15 as-of-date features and anti-leakage chassis as p_chow_12m; SFF entry rejected as a label (only one month of SFF history exists, so as-of transitions cannot be reconstructed). Score = probability x 100; grade NULL. Not in any composite. |
| p chow 12m | 7.4 | — | v0.1 | default · in composite | R22/W4-2. Deterministic logistic p(CHOW within 12m), SNF only. Trained on panels 2024-07/2024-10/2025-01 (n=50,700, 1,207 positives), evaluated on the held-out later panel 2025-04 BEFORE shipping: AUC 0.874, top-decile lift 5.0x (top 10% of predictions captured 49.6% of the CHOWs that actually closed in the next 12 months). Shipped coefficients are the evaluated ones; no post-holdout refit. Caveat: holdout positives (133) run below the training base rate because recent CHOWs surface in public records with a lag, so measured lift is conservative. Features are as-of-date public records: PBJ staffing level/trend/contract share (quarterly history to 2022Q1), deficiency and CMP counts (12m), ownership tenure and churn from CHOW-evidenced transactions, beds, occupancy, ownership type, chain size. Chain membership and ownership type are current-state (history not published). SFF and star ratings deliberately excluded (no as-of history). Notable learned direction: long ownership tenure RAISES sale odds and a recent prior CHOW lowers them. Score = probability x 100; grade is NULL because a probability is not a quality letter. Not in any composite. |
